Luca Panetta
Biography
Luca trained at LAMDA (London Academy of Music & Dramatic Arts) and now is a freelance lighting designer, video designer and lighting programmer and associate.
Recent Lighting & Video Design Credits include
If Opera's 2023 Season Fedora, Alice's Adventures in Wonderland, and Iolanta (If Opera); Polko (Paines Plough Roundabout); Edith (The Lowry / Theatr Clwyd); Cendrillon (Royal Birmingham Conservatoire); If Opera's 2022 Season La Rondine, Il segreto di Susanna, and Rita (If Opera- Belcombe Court); Diary of a Somebody (Seven Dials Playhouse) for which he was nominated for an Offie in Lighting Design; The Faction’s 2021 Triple Bill of Medea/Worn, Douglass, and Duende(Wilton’s Music Hall, & Stephen Joseph Theatre); A Double Bill of The Wardrobe Ensemble's Education, Education, Education and The Last of the Pelican Daughters directed by Sarah Frankcom (ArtsEd ALWF Theatre); Jesus Christ Superstar (Sainsbury Theatre); The Wonderful World of Dissocia (Sainsbury Theatre); La Forza Del Destino (Regents Opera); Cymbeline(Sainsbury Theatre); Julius Caesar (Sainsbury Theatre).
Sole Video Designer Credits include: The Dream Collectors (Derby Theatre).
Credits as Associate Lighting Designer and LX Programmer include:
Associate : Macbeth (Liverpool, Edinburgh, London, Washington DC); The Merchant of Venice 1936(RSC, & UK Tour); The Real & Imagined History of The Elephant Man (UK Tour); A Playlist for the Revolution (Bush Theatre); Worth (Storyhouse Chester); Cinderella (Theatre Royal Stratford East);
Credits as Video Associate include: Mind Mangler: Member of the Tragic Circle (Mischief Theatre UK Tour, & Virgin Voyages); Carousel (RAM)
Programmer : A View From The Bridge (Chichester Festival Theatre & Rose Theatre); The Homecoming (Young Vic); Richard My Richard (Shakespeare North Playhouse); Death Trap 2023 (Rambert UK Tour); The Enfield Haunting (West End); Cinderella (Theatre Royal Stratford East); Sons of the Prophet (Hampstead Theatre); Christmas Carol (Belgrade Theatre); The Apology (Arcola Theatre); The Fellowship (Hampstead Theatre); Mary (Hampstead Theatre); Cinderella: The AWESOME Truth (Polka Theatre); 60 Miles by Road or Rail (Royal & Derngate)
